How to prepare for a job interview at The Connaught
✨Know Your Pastry Techniques
Brush up on your pastry skills and techniques before the interview. Be ready to discuss your favourite methods, ingredients, and any unique recipes you've created. This shows your passion and expertise in the field.
✨Research The Connaught
Familiarise yourself with The Connaught's history, values, and culinary style. Understanding their approach to hospitality and cuisine will help you align your answers with what they’re looking for in a candidate.
✨Prepare for Practical Questions
Expect questions about how you handle pressure in a busy kitchen or how you approach teamwork. Think of specific examples from your past experiences that highlight your problem-solving skills and ability to work collaboratively.
✨Show Your Creativity
As a pastry chef, creativity is key! Be prepared to discuss your inspirations and how you incorporate them into your work. Maybe even bring a portfolio of your best creations to showcase your talent and flair.
